New procedure on precise analysis of superconducting phase qubits using the concept of Feynman path integral in quantum mechanics and quantum field theory has been introduced. The wave function and imaginary part of the energy of the pseudo ground state of the Hamiltonian in phase qubits has been obtained from semi classical approximation and we we estimate decay rate, and thus the life time of meta stable using the approach of Instanton model. We devote the main effort to study the evolution of spectrum of Hamiltonian in time after addition of interaction Hamiltonian, in order to obtain the high fidelity quantum gates.
